Output 04ae184c697952aff104e482775d0f5c15a2dff69680286346ceb700acb2eb9b:1

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66ff8ca40ef1e839651708a4df1900983867423 OP_EQUAL
address
3KnFrTy1s2X2zcECoxfMvyHkrto5HZwuij
transaction
04ae184c697952aff104e482775d0f5c15a2dff69680286346ceb700acb2eb9b
confirmations
339882
spent
true